Am 21.08.18 um 14:56 schrieb Leandro: > Which is your sample rate ? Our routers do not allow 1:1 sampling anymore so we take the data from a SPAN port and convert them to netflow sending it to the nfsen machine. I am through with yaf, yaf2 and pmacctd, at the moment softflowd seems to work best.

What counts are the flows you have, not the bandwidth. Here are some numbers of our university uplink, to give you a feeling: Flows: ~50k/s in, the same out Packets: ~1Mp/s in, the same out Bits: typically 10-20 Gbit/s in, ~5Gbits/ out This gives me ~500GByte/d But remember: the used disk
